Textile Knitting and Weaving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ders salary by percentile in Wisconsin
BLS-reported salary distribution — from entry-level (10th percentile) to top earners (90th percentile).
Textile Knitting and Weaving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ders in Wisconsin earn a median salary of $45,610 per year ($3,800/month).
This is 10.9% above the national average of $41,132.
Wisconsin ranks #6 out of 25 states for Textile Knitting and Weaving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ders pay.
Approximately 150 people work in this occupation across Wisconsin.
Salaries decreased by 30.7% compared to 2024.
About This Job: Textile Knitting and Weaving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ders
Set up, operate, or tend machines that knit, loop, weave, or draw in textiles.

Salary Range: Textile Knitting and Weaving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ders in Wisconsin
Salaries for Textile Knitting and Weaving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ders in Wisconsin range from $31,810 at the 10th percentile (entry level) to $68,970 at the 90th percentile (experienced). The middle 50% earn between $37,280 and $61,060.

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ey, 2025 estimates. The OEWS survey covers approximately 1.1 million establishments nationwide.
Annual salaries are calculated based on a standard 2,080-hour work year.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, education, employer, and local market conditions. Figures do not include benefits, bonuses, or overtime pay.
